Lipo, short for liposuction, is a popular cosmetic treatment made to eliminate persistent fat down payments from numerous locations of the body. It's usually made use of for areas like the abdominal area, thighs, and arms. Throughout the treatment, a specialist utilizes a slim tube, called a cannula, to suck out excess fat. You'll normally obtain anesthesia, ensuring you're comfy throughout the process.


Liposuction isn't a weight-loss solution; it targets certain areas to boost your body shape (Lipo In Austin). Before undergoing the treatment, it's essential to have practical expectations. While it can substantially enhance your body shape, maintaining a healthy and balanced way of life is essential for long-term results


Healing differs from individual to individual, however numerous people go back to regular activities within a week. It's required to follow your doctor's post-operative advice to advertise recovery and accomplish the ideal feasible result.


Kinds Of Liposuction Surgery Techniques



When taking into consideration liposuction surgery, it is very important to understand that there are different strategies readily available, each customized to meet various demands and choices. Typical lipo uses a cannula to suction fat from targeted areas through little lacerations. Tumescent liposuction surgery involves injecting a remedy to numb the location and minimize bleeding.


Laser-assisted liposuction surgery, or SmartLipo, uses laser power to dissolve fat before elimination, making it less invasive and advertising skin tightening up (Liposuction Surgeon Austin TX). Ultrasound-assisted liposuction employs ultrasound waves to damage down fat cells, making them much easier to remove


For a gentler technique, power-assisted lipo uses a vibrating cannula, reducing the initiative needed for fat elimination. Each method has its benefits and possible drawbacks, so it's important to talk about these options with your surgeon. Recognizing these strategies can aid you make an enlightened decision that straightens with your objectives.


Perfect Candidates for Lipo Treatment



Ideal prospects for lipo treatment normally have certain qualities that make them ideal for the treatment. You must be at or near your excellent weight, as lipo isn't a weight-loss option but a fat reduction approach. Great skin elasticity is also vital; this assists your skin satisfy your brand-new body form post-treatment. You're much more likely to be an excellent candidate. if you're in excellent general health and do not have problems that could make complex surgical treatment.

Possible Risks and Issues



Although lipo therapy is generally safe, it's crucial to be conscious of possible threats and problems that can occur. There's likewise the risk of excessive bleeding, leading to hematomas or even needing extra procedures.


In unusual situations, you can experience much more major complications like blood clots or negative reactions to anesthesia. Nerve damage is one more possibility, causing short-lived or irreversible feeling numb in the cured area. In addition, you could manage liquid buildup, calling for drain.


It's important to have a truthful conversation with your cosmetic surgeon about these risks and assure you're well-informed. By recognizing these prospective problems, you can make a more enlightened choice concerning whether lipo therapy is ideal for you.

Task Constraints Period



While you're recuperating from lipo treatment, it's essential to understand the task limitations you'll deal with. Commonly, you need to prevent difficult activities for a minimum of two weeks post-procedure. This consists of heavy training, extreme workouts, and any kind of high-impact exercises. Light walking is urged to advertise blood flow, however listen to your body. After the preliminary 2 weeks, you can slowly reestablish moderate activities, yet constantly examine with your doctor for tailored support. Full healing may take several weeks, and it's essential to focus on rest throughout this period. Take notice of your body's signals, and don't hurry back right into your regular regimen. Sticking to these limitations will certainly aid guarantee a smoother healing and far better outcomes from your lipo treatment.

Expense Factors To Consider and Budgeting for Lipo





Lipo therapy can substantially vary in expense, making it essential to understand what affects rates before deciding. Numerous aspects come right into play, including the kind of lipo treatment, the doctor's experience, and your geographical place. Usually, you can expect costs to vary from $2,000 to $7,000 per session.


Don't neglect to make up added costs, such as anesthetic, center costs, and post-operative treatment. It's important to consult with multiple facilities to compare costs and services. Some facilities use funding alternatives or layaway plan, which can help spread the expense with time.


Before committing, confirm you're clear on what's consisted of in the priced quote cost. Bear in mind, the most affordable alternative isn't always the finest; prioritize high quality and security over savings. By budgeting very carefully and doing your research study, you can make an educated decision that lines up with your economic situation.

Exist Non-Surgical Alternatives to Liposuction?



Yes, there are non-surgical options to lipo, like CoolSculpting, laser fat reduction, and ultrasound therapies. These approaches target fat cells without surgical procedure, helping you achieve your preferred outcomes with less downtime and very little pain.
